Former Evansville Fire Chief Paul Anslinger has been arrested on felony charges.
A warrant for his arrest was issued on Tuesday for 3 counts of theft and one count of official misconduct.
In April, police confirmed an active investigation involving Anslinger and missing tools.
When questioned, Anslinger told police they were not stolen and he knew where they were.
Police also claim he had a handgun owned by EFD.
He was booked on a $10,000 surety bond around 3:45 Tuesday afternoon, then bonded out.
